Electromagnetic M1 Transition Strengths from Inelastic Proton Scattering: The Cases of 48 Ca and 208 Pb

Summary.{A new method for the extraction of spin-ipM1 strength from inelastic proton scattering at forwardangles has been presented relating it to the GT strengthstudied with the analog (p;n) reaction. The underlyingapproximations were shown to be well justi ed for thecase of the prominent transition in 48 Ca. The extractedB(M1) strength in 48 Ca agrees with the (e;e 0 ) result [20].The much larger value from a recent (;n) experiment[22] is clearly in conict with the precise (e;e 0 ) and (p;p 0 )results derived by completely independent methods. Ap-plication to 208 Pb shows again good agreement with elec-tromagnetic probes and also highlights the sensitivity ofthe new method above the neutron threshold, where sig-ni cant additional strength is found not accessible in theprevious work. This nding has important consequencesfor an understanding of the quenching of the spin-isospinresponse, which will be discussed in a forthcoming pa-per.
